Provide the invisible link in combining glass and plastic glazing materials Higher impact resistance and lower weight than is possible with all glass constructionsKrystalflex® polyurethane films are usedto combine glass and an optical-quality, high impact plastic sheet, such as polycarbonate, for a wide range of bullet resistant or impact resistant glazing composites

Low temperature processing (T=80-140°C):• High quality laminations• Low energy use • Few thermal stress issues in the finished products
Processability
Processability
A fully-reacted product• No cross-linking• Thermoplastic Polyurethane (TPU) material
You only have to reshape it into the final form
